Color picker: Eat motion events to avoid over-rendering

...when spamming the event queue with motion events over the
value slider, while Tux Paint is busy re-rendering the
rainbow palette at the new Value level.

Also, convert a printf() in the new color picker crosshair sizing
function to DEBUG_PRINTF().
